Description
Key Features
Part of the respected Oxford Avian Biology Series by Oxford University Press.
Provides a critical and exhaustive review of interspecific competition in nature.
Uses birds as a primary model due to the extensive experimental data available for this group.
Examines how competition, predation, and mutualism shape biological communities.
Addresses controversial and unresolved questions regarding the importance of competition in ecology.
